Victorian Jewellery

This unique volume-provides an intriguing historical account of nineteenth century jewellery and describes how types of jewellery were influenced by changes in dress, hairstyles, living standards and period economics.

An introduction explains the role of jewellery in Victorian life, with early to mid and late Victorian periods each receiving a chapter of general discussion. Of special note are the illustrations of ladies costumed in exquisite morning dress, day wear and evening costumes-accompanied by appropriate necklaces, ear-rings and bracelets. Additional illustrations depict specific pieces; brooches in gold and silver, set with seed pearls, rubies and opals; necklaces of pearls, garnets, amethysts; and other lavish pieces.

Quotes from contemporary fashion writers provide an idea of what Victorians thought of their own jewels. Both inexpensive jewellery as well as important and valuable pieces are depicted, making this book extremely valuable to those fascinated by the contents of old jewellery boxes as well as to those interested in precious stones set with exacting craftsmanship. A glossary of terms, a bibliography together with a full index complete this extremely useful reference work.

115 half-tones; 66 line illustrations; 10 colour plates; Index; 304 pages; Paperback.
